What is Texas Campaign Finance Report

The Texas Ethics Commission Campaign Finance Report is a government form used by candidates and officeholders in Texas to report campaign finance activities.

Comprehensive Guide to Texas Campaign Finance Report

Understanding the Texas Ethics Commission Campaign Finance Report

The Texas Ethics Commission Campaign Finance Report acts as a critical tool for candidates and officeholders to disclose their campaign financing activities. This comprehensive form is essential for ensuring transparency in political financing within the state. Required signatures from candidates or officeholders and their campaign treasurers further solidify the integrity of the report.

Purpose and Benefits of the Texas Ethics Commission Campaign Finance Report

This campaign finance report is vital for compliance with Texas election laws, which maintain the accountability of candidates. Proper submission benefits candidates by keeping their campaigns within legal boundaries and enhancing their standing with voters. Moreover, the report helps clarify the financial underpinnings of campaigns, fostering a better understanding among the electorate.

Who Needs to File the Texas Ethics Commission Campaign Finance Report?

The filing requirement encompasses several key roles: candidates, officeholders, and campaign treasurers must complete the form. For instance, anyone running for election in Texas must disclose their financial records. However, there may be exceptions or unique cases that allow certain individuals to bypass this obligation.

Filing Requirements and Deadlines

Filing timelines are specific, with key deadlines set for submissions. Missing these deadlines may lead to penalties that could impact a campaign's legitimacy. To submit a complete report, candidates must gather necessary documents and supporting materials, including detailed transaction records that reflect contributions and expenditures.
  • Understand the exact submission dates for your election cycle.
  • Prepare accompanying documentation to support your financial disclosures.
  • Be aware of the penalties associated with late or absent filings.

Understanding Notarization and Signature Requirements

An affidavit section of the form necessitates notarization, which adds an additional layer of verification. Candidates must choose between digital signatures and traditional wet signatures, each having distinct advantages and requirements. Successfully completing this process ensures the form is validated and accepted.

The report must be submitted by candidates for public office, officeholders, and campaign treasurers in Texas. It is essential for monitoring campaign finance activities and ensuring compliance with Texas election laws.
You will need detailed information about contributions, expenditures, and loans. Additionally, personal identification from the candidate, officeholder, and campaign treasurer is required to complete the form.
Yes, the Texas Ethics Commission Campaign Finance Report requires an affidavit section to be notarized, which adds a layer of verification to ensure the authenticity of the submitted information.
Deadlines vary depending on the election cycle. Typically, forms must be submitted at specific intervals leading up to an election. It's crucial to check with the Texas Ethics Commission for exact dates and compliance requirements.
Yes, you can submit the Texas Ethics Commission Campaign Finance Report online through the Texas Ethics Commission's official website or by using pdfFiller for electronic submission.
Common mistakes include omitting required information, failing to notarize the affidavit, and missing submission deadlines. Always double-check that all necessary fields are filled in and that the form is signed appropriately.
Processing times can vary. Typically, once submitted, the Texas Ethics Commission will review the report and notify you if there are any issues, generally within a few weeks.
